访问元素和提取子集是数据框的基本操作,在pandas中,提供了多种方式。...对于一个数据框而言,既有从0开始的整数下标索引,也有行列的标签索引
>>> df = pd.DataFrame(np.random.randn(4, 4), index=['r1', 'r2', 'r3...r2 -1.416611
r3 -0.640207
r4 -2.254314
Name: A, dtype: float64
# 当然,你可以在列对应的Series对象中再次进行索引操作,访问对应元素...True对应的元素,本次示例如下
>>> df = pd.DataFrame(np.random.randn(4, 4), index=['r1', 'r2', 'r3', 'r4'], columns...dtype: bool
# 利用布尔数组,提取C,D两列
>>> df.loc[:, df.loc['r1'] > 0]
C D
r1 0.109313 0.186309
r2